What Is a Message Sequence?

A message sequence is a series of automated messages that are triggered by certain events or actions. For example, you might create a sequence of messages that are sent out each time someone subscribes to your email list. Or you might create a sequence of messages that are sent out each time someone purchases a product from your online store.

Message sequences can be as simple or complex as you like. You can create sequences that contain just a few messages, or you can create sequences that contain dozens or even hundreds of messages.
